Buying Guide

Match technical level to your background

Choose introductory texts if you are new to quantum or atomic physics and advanced monographs if you have undergraduate-level math and physics experience

Prioritize authoritative authors

Look for works by recognized physicists and historians like CERN researchers or academic press authors to ensure accurate, well-sourced material

Consider language and edition

Several strong choices are German-language editions; pick translations or language editions that match your reading comfort

Balance theory and application

If you want practical methods, favor books covering numerical methods or spectroscopy; for historical or conceptual context, choose collider histories or overview texts
